WebSpeed Control of DC Shunt Motor. ... By increasing the value of resistance, the field current decrease and hence the flux is reduced. From the equation of speed, the flux is inversely … WebIf the value of external resistance increases, the voltage across the armature and current from the armature winding is reduced. And the speed will be decreased. By this method, the speed of the motor only decreases from the level of speed when external resistance is not connected. The speed of a motor cannot increase from this level.
